10.It is very important for people to drink water in our everyday life.Many people believe they are supposed to drink eight glasses of water a day,or about two liters.Why?Because that is what they have been told all their life.But a recent report offers some different advice.Experts say people should obey their bodies; they should drink as much water as they feel like drinking.The report says most healthy people meet their daily needs for liquid by letting thirst be their guide.The report is from the Institute of Medicine,part of the National Academies.The report contains some general suggestions.The experts say women should get about 2.7liters of water daily.Men should get about 3.7liters.But wait--in each case,that is more than eight glasses.There is one important difference.The report does not tell people how many glasses of water to drink.In fact,the experts say it may be impossible to know how many glasses are needed to meet these guidelines.This is because the daily water requirement can include the water content in foods.People do not get water only by forcing themselves to drink a set number of glasses per day.People also drink fruit juices and sodas and milk.They drink coffee and tea.These all contain water.Yet some also contain caffeine.This causes the body to expel(排出)more water.But the writers of the report say this does not mean the body loses too much water.
As you might expect,the Institute of Medicine says people need to drink more water when they are physically active.The same is true of those who live in hot climates.Depending on heat and activity,people could need two times as much water as others do.All this,however,does not answer one question.No one seems sure why people have the idea that good health requires eight glasses of water daily.
It may have started with a misunderstanding.In 1945,the National Academy of Sciences published some guidelines.Its Food and Nutrition Board(营养膳食) said a good amount of water for most adults was 2.5liters daily.This was based on an average of one milliliter(毫升)for each calorie of food eaten.But that was only part of what the board said.It also said that most of this amount is contained in prepared foods.

It's been said that"everybody lies sometimes."And it's true.Everyone does lie from time to time.Men lie; women lie.Husbands lie,friends lie,wives lie,and believe it or not,your mother might lie.A recent study showed that 91% of all people lie on a regular basis,and people tell at least 13major lies a week.

The first thing one has to understand about lying is that there are at least five different types of liars:the model of absolute integrity,the real straight-shooter,the pragmatic fibber,a real Pinocchio and the compulsive liar,according to sociologist-anthropologist Dr.Gina Graham Scott.

Dr.Robert G.Newby,the professor of sociology at Central Michigan University,believes that men are more likely to tell lies than women."Men are more concerned about how they present themselves in public,the impression they make on people and things like that,"he says."Men are always trying to impress people in the work and want to make sure that their presentation of self is one that makes them look good."Women,on the other hand,Dr.Newby believes,are more private people and their relationship tends to be more interpersonal,as opposed to having to put on a public face.Women are more vulnerable and they are not as likely to try to pull the wool over someone's eyes like men.

Dr Ronn Elmore,Los Angeles-based relationship counselor,does not believe that lying is based on gender."But I believe when women lie it tends to be verbal,plain old-fashioned lies with words.But when men lie,it is often nonverbal,as in doing what he says he would not do or not doing what he promised he would do.Either way,it's a lie,male version or female version.It is the opposite of integrity."

Vesta Callender,psychotherapist in New York City,also agrees that one's gender does not play a role in lying,but men and women do lie differently."Women concern more while lying.They plan better,"Callender notes."They create a history around the lie,and they try to project into the future what might happen if the lie is detected.With a woman,a lie has a beginning,a middle and an end.It's a real entanglement."Callender believes that men"tend to lie for the moment or to get out of a situation.Men think less about how the lie can be detected."
